Inter-professional learning (IPL) is a key component of health workforce development. This study evaluated IPL at Health2GO, a university-based allied health clinic, using the PROLIFERATE_AI digital evaluation framework. The analysis combined participatory co-design, Bayesian modelling of survey responses, and qualitative thematic coding to assess comprehension, engagement, barriers, and motivation. Most participants reported a strong understanding and motivation, but some experienced barriers related to scheduling and accessing flexible resources. Integrated findings informed recommendations for improving session clarity, flexibility, and digital access in IPL programs.
